HYDAC - 3041177

HYDAC - 3041177


HYDAC  -  3041177
(In Stock)

MOBILE FILTRATION SYSTEM - FCM-100-G-N-3B05-B/-S5D5-V

Request a quotation for this product

We accept credit card payment